Why These Are the Top Bathroom Remodeling Contractors in Wild Horse

** The bathroom remodeling market serving Wild Horse, Colorado, is characterized by a small, localized pool of contractors primarily based in Cheyenne Wells and other nearby county seats. Due to the rural nature of the region, competition is limited but the quality of the established providers is generally high, as they rely heavily on community reputation and word-of-mouth. Homeowners should expect to pay a premium compared to urban areas due to higher material transportation costs and potential travel fees for the contractors. Typical pricing for a full bathroom remodel in this region can range from $15,000 for a basic update to $35,000+ for a high-end, custom renovation with accessibility features. The lead times for project initiation may also be longer than in metropolitan areas, as these local contractors are often booked well in advance. It is highly recommended to secure multiple estimates and verify current licensing and insurance directly with any chosen provider before commencing work.

Frequently Asked Questions About Bathroom Remodeling in Wild Horse

Get answers to common questions about bathroom remodeling services in Wild Horse, Colorado.

1What is the typical cost range for a full bathroom remodel in Wild Horse, and what factors influence the price?

In Wild Horse and the surrounding Cheyenne County area, a full bathroom remodel typically ranges from $15,000 to $35,000+, depending on the scope and materials. Key cost factors include the size of your bathroom, the quality of fixtures (like water-efficient models suited for our semi-arid climate), and the extent of plumbing/electrical work needed. Labor and material transportation costs can also be slightly higher here due to our rural location, requiring contractors to travel greater distances.

2How does the high plains climate and weather in Wild Horse impact bathroom remodeling choices?

Wild Horse's high plains climate, with its low humidity, wide temperature swings, and hard water, should guide your material selections. We recommend using humidity-resistant materials like mold-resistant drywall and proper ventilation fans to handle steam from showers during cold winters. Additionally, choosing fixtures and finishes that resist mineral buildup from hard water and can withstand interior dryness will ensure your remodel lasts longer and looks better.

3Are there specific permits or regulations in Cheyenne County I need to be aware of for a bathroom remodel?

Yes, for most structural, plumbing, and electrical work, you will need permits from Cheyenne County Building Department. Local codes will govern aspects like proper venting, GFCI outlet placement for safety, and water conservation standards. It's crucial to hire a contractor familiar with these local regulations, as they can handle the permit process and ensure inspections are passed, avoiding costly fines or rework.

4What's the best time of year to schedule a bathroom remodel in this region, and how long does it usually take?

While interior remodels can be done year-round, late spring through early fall is often ideal, as contractors are most active and material deliveries are less likely to be delayed by the snowstorms and icy conditions common on our rural roads from November to March. A typical full remodel takes 3 to 6 weeks from demolition to completion, but this timeline can extend due to the logistics of sourcing materials to our remote area and the availability of specialized subcontractors.

5How can I find and vet a reliable bathroom remodeling contractor serving the Wild Horse area?

Given the rural nature of our community, seek contractors licensed in Colorado with proven experience in Cheyenne County or similar Eastern Plains locations. Ask for local references you can contact and verify they carry proper insurance. A reputable local contractor will understand the specific challenges of working in our area, from well water systems to coordinating with inspectors, and should provide a detailed, written contract outlining the project scope, timeline, and payment schedule.
